=IF(ISERROR(VLOOKUP($M2,明细!A:D,4,0)),"",VLOOKUP($M2,明细!A:D,4

问题描述:

=IF(ISERROR(VLOOKUP($M2,明细!A:D,4,0)),"",VLOOKUP($M2,明细!A:D,4,0))
如何用vba代码在EXCEL表格里O2列实现上面公式所表达的意思,如需要具体表格可以留下联系方式,谢谢O3列=IF(ISERROR(VLOOKUP($M3,明细!A:D,4,0)),"",VLOOKUP($M3,明细!A:D,4,0)).依次类推
1个回答 分类:综合 2014-11-17

问题解答:

我来补答
Sub aa()
A = Sheets("表的名称").Range("m65536").End(xlUp).Row
B = Sheets("明细").Range("a65536").End(xlUp).Row
For i = 1 To A
For j = 1 To B
If Sheets("表的名称").Cells(i, 13) = Sheets("明细").Cells(j, 1) Then
Sheets("表的名称").Cells(i, 15) = Sheets("明细").Cells(j, 4)
End If
Next
Next
End Su
 
 
展开全文阅读
剩余:2000
下一页:先解十一题